N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ING

 

            Pursuant to KRS 132.027, as amended by the Kentucky General Assembly Extraordinary Session of 1979, the City of Russellville will hold a Public Hearing on Tuesday, September 12, 2023 at 4:45 p.m. at City Hall, Russellville, Kentucky to hear comments from the public regarding the proposed 2023 Tax Rates on Real Property.

 

            As required by law, this includes the following information:

 

Tax Rate per
$100 Assessed
Valuation

 

                                                                                                    Revenue:

1.   Preceding Year Tax Rate and Revenue            .255            925,759
Produced from Real Property

2.   Tax Rate Proposed for Current Year and          .255            964,707
Expected Revenue from Real Property

3.   Compensating Tax Rate and Expected            .245            926,875
Revenue from Real Property

4.   Revenue Expected from New Real                                          N/A
Property - Less Exemptions

5.   Preceding Year Tax Rate and Revenue           .329           207,296
Produced from Personal Property      

6.   Tax Rate Proposed for Current Year and         .329          238,895
Revenue Expected from Personal Property      

 

            The City of Russellville proposes to exceed the compensating rate by levying a proposed rate of .255, the same rate as for the 2022 year.   If revenues are in excess of the revenue produced in the preceding year, revenues will be spent in the following areas of City government:  Administrative, Police, Fire, Streets, Cemeteries, Parks and Recreation and Service Center.
